Is the Midnight Airdrop Legitimate?

Being vigilant is recommended in the Cryptocurrency market including any airdrop particularly Midnight Airdrop.

All Trusted Projects will follow the trend of NOT asking for, requesting or requiring the share of your Private Keys or Recovery Phrases. A Good majority of the time the only action required when taking part in the airdrop is to connect your Wallet, to Test Net Features and Complete Essentially On-chain Logical Activities.

Verify the authenticity of airdrop affiliate links; do NOT click on these links unless you received them from a verified and official source. If you receive link(s) to an airdrop from an unverified sender via direct message, it’s high risk to click the link(s). If an airdrop link is being sent from an official source but you don’t trust the sender for any reason, you probably are getting scammed. As a member of the Cryptocurrency Community you must be vigilant and educated to avoid scams.

Overview of a Typical Claim Process

Once eligibility is confirmed, claiming tokens typically follows a simple process:

Visit the official claim page

Connect your wallet

Confirm eligibility

Sign a transaction

That’s it. No payments, no sending funds, no complicated steps.

This moment is often what people mean when they talk about a free crypto claim. The value comes from your earlier participation, not from paying upfront.

Gas Fees and Small Costs

While tokens may be free, claiming them often requires a small network fee. This is normal and unavoidable in most blockchains.

The fee doesn’t go to the project—it goes to network validators. Planning for this small cost avoids frustration later.

If fees seem unusually high, it’s often a sign to pause and double-check what you’re doing.

After you claim your tokens, they will most likely appear in your wallet within moments or after a slight delay. If your token is locked or vested, it means that you cannot immediately sell it. This is done to encourage participation in the project over the long term rather than simply selling the tokens as soon as they are received. The documentation on the project will provide details on the various ways and the timing of use of your tokens.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Many users make the same mistakes when chasing airdrops:

Clicking unofficial links

Using wallets with exposed private keys

Rushing through steps without reading

Connecting wallets to unknown contracts

Avoiding these mistakes is often more important than completing every possible task.

In crypto, protecting what you already have is just as important as gaining something new.
